Description

Make a professional difference in the Nation’s Capital.  The DC Public Service Commission, a leading utility regulatory agency, is seeking a talented senior electrical engineer!

 As a senior engineering professional, you will be deployed on a challenging variety of regulatory oversight projects, including ongoing monitoring efforts for multi-billion dollar long-term electric utility infrastructure upgrade projects, electric distribution strategic initiatives, and distributed energy resource technologies, including energy storage and microgrids.

In this role, you can interface with key stakeholders from various federal and state agencies, including the DOE, FERC, and DC's DOEE and DDOT agencies. You will also interface with engineering professionals of Fortune 500 energy companies, energy developers and providers, and regulatory professionals across the Nation. You will gain significant industry exposure and unmatched professional experience as a member of a leading regulatory agency with a proud 100+ year history of regulatory excellence.

The Commission is deploying a hybrid telework schedule, which includes three days per week of teleworking and two days each week in our 13th and G  Street offices.   We also offer flex time schedules. The Commission also provides a competitive salary range, a generous travel stipend for public transportation, and an attractive benefits package. The Commission's benefits package encompasses a flexible menu of comprehensive benefits, including health, dental, vision, life, and disability insurance options, and a robust set of portable retirement benefits and savings options. The Commission also offers attractive vacation and sick leave time and paid holidays, consistent with District government provisions.



Requirements

Education and Other Requirements

Bachelor’s degree in electrical engineering is required.

Master’s degree in either engineering or business is highly desirable.

 PE license in electrical engineering is beneficial.

 Valid Driver’s License.
